William Rankine, a designer and physicist, developed an alternate to Coulomb's planet stress theory. Albert Atterberg created the clay consistency indices that are still made use of today for soil classification. In 1885, Osborne Reynolds acknowledged that shearing reasons volumetric expansion of dense materials and tightening of loose granular products. Modern geotechnical engineering is claimed to have begun in 1925 with the publication of Erdbaumechanik by Karl von Terzaghi, a mechanical engineer and geologist.

Terzaghi additionally created the framework for theories of birthing capability of structures, and the theory for forecast of the price of negotiation of clay layers as a result of loan consolidation. After that, Maurice Biot completely created the three-dimensional dirt combination concept, prolonging the one-dimensional model formerly developed by Terzaghi to more basic hypotheses and presenting the collection of basic formulas of Poroelasticity.

Geotechnical designers can assess and enhance slope security using engineering techniques. A formerly stable slope may be at first influenced by various elements, making it unstable. Geotechnical engineers can create and execute engineered inclines to increase stability.


If the interface between the mass and the base of a slope has an intricate geometry, slope security analysis is tough and mathematical solution techniques are called for. Typically, the interface's specific geometry is unknown, and a simplified interface geometry is thought. Limited slopes require three-dimensional designs to be examined, so most inclines are assessed assuming that they are definitely large and can be stood for by two-dimensional designs.

Geotechnical design is a subset of civil engineering that concentrates on how planet materials like soil, rock and groundwater engage with manufactured structures, such as structures, bridges, dams and roadways. The objective is to make sure that the subsurface - the geology beneath any type of building and construction - can sustaining whatever is built on top.
